Beavers Fall to Cougars, 61-55.

Omari Johnson for the Beavers tangles with Washington state's Deangelo Casto.

CORVALLIS, Ore. -- Reggie Moore had 14 points and DeAngelo Casto added 11 points and 10 rebounds to lead Washington State to a 61-55 win against Oregon State Saturday night.

The Cougars (16-7, 6-5 Pac-10) overcame an off-night from leading scorer Klay Thompson, who had six points on 2-of-7 shooting and fouled out with 1:57 left.

Devon Collier had a career-high 16 points and 10 rebounds for Oregon State (9-13, 4-7), which led only once, at 11-10.

The Beavers cut a 10-point second-half deficit to two, but Washington State steadily built its edge back to 10, going ahead 41-31 on Casto's three-point play with 12:49 left.

Collier's lay-in got Oregon State within 45-41 before Moore and Marcus Caspers each had three-point plays to increase the Cougars' margin again.

Oregon State got within 57-55 with 20 seconds left on Roberto Nelson's basket, but Faisal Adian made four free throws to close the scoring.
